Job Description: The Primary Health Care (PHC) Registered Nurse (RN) is an integral member of the primary health care team, providing and coordinating initial, continuing and comprehensive nursing services to patients in the PHC sites. The PHC RN promotes quality health care outcomes working within established standards for case management practice to ensure that patients/clients receive a high standard of primary health care. This will be done in accordance with Sunrise Health Region mission statement and Integrated Primary Health Services policies and procedures of the facility and department. The PHC RN initiates and/or participates in community development initiatives within the site. The PHC/RN reports to their respective Primary Health Care manager.
